The back of the caseback, which protects the sapphire crystal back, has only a few claws to open and close it, and no hinges can be found, no matter how hard one looks.
Patek Philippe's Calatrava 5227 combines the Calatrava, a well-known masterpiece, with the dust cover, the symbolic mechanism of the Officer, another masterpiece.
Patek Philippe has been manufacturing not only the movements but also the cases in-house, including design, manufacturing, and polishing. Hinges are no exception. The beautiful sound of the opening and closing of the caseback, which disappears as soon as it closes, can be attributed to the fact that Patek Philippe is able to make adjustments on a micron level.
. The exceptional aesthetics are, of course, also evident on the "front" of the watch, with its slightly concave bezel, gracefully curved lugs, and rack-ivory dial. The slightly concave bezel, elegantly curved lugs, and rack-ivory dial, all in a 39-millimeter 18-karat gold case, are the epitome of elegance. In keeping with the Bauhaus philosophy, the dial is unparalleled in its pursuit of legibility and beauty.
The movement is the caliber 324 S C. It offers the ultimate in precision, with a day difference of -3 to +2 seconds, in accordance with Patek Philippe Seal certification standards.
